Scheduled for release on November 19, the book promises an intimate exploration of Palmer's life, succeeding her debut book "I Don't Belong to You," published in 2017.
Excerpts shared with People Magazine reveal that Palmer describes her time with Jackson as one of the most challenging experiences she has encountered.
The stress, she explained, was exacerbated by the demands of recent parenthood.
“Having a baby… not just with my romantic relationships, but with family and friends, it’s always become a burden. Too many voices get in. It can make everybody else not trust you. It’s hard to explain,” she wrote.
The actress described her connection with Jackson as “deeply spiritual”.
She also explained how they both struggled with loneliness and created a bond that ultimately led to their decision to have a son.
“It was like, not only is this the person, but this is the time. It felt very spiritual for Darius and I,” she said.
“We had separate lonelinesses, and we created a space for us to exist in that loneliness together. And then we wanted to have a son. Leo was very planned”.Palmer said as the relationship progressed, “it got so out of control”. She added that she now feels a sense of peace and would never speak negatively about her ex for their son’s sake.
“I feel very at ease now knowing things are under control,” she added.
“I didn’t want my son to think his father is a monster, because I don’t.”
The couple’s relationship, which went public in 2021, became the subject of scrutiny in July 2023 when Jackson publicly criticised Palmer’s outfit at a concert by singer Usher.
Shortly after, the actress filed for a restraining order against Jackson, citing allegations of domestic violence and seeking sole custody of their son.
